Responsibilities

  • Serves meals and ensures that the dining area is clean and inviting:

  • Follows meal serving schedule and procedures.

  • Offers resident meal choices and meets resident’s specific dietary needs.

  • Uses proper safety and sanitation techniques.

  • Follows dining room cleaning schedule and procedures.

  • Follow proper procedures for dining room set-up.

  • Follows proper work flow to stay on task.

  • Learns and becomes proficient with EMenu System and restaurant style service.

  • Ensures all dishes (including flatware, drinkware, etc.) are washed, sanitized, and put away before end of shift.

  • Promotes and encourages positive resident relations and satisfaction:

  • Welcomes residents and initiates conversation.

  • Accommodates resident requests such as requests for food substitution, change in seating, etc.

  • Listens to any complaints and responds appropriately. Refers issues to Executive Director and Culinary Director as appropriate.
